Hyundai launched its new H1 11-seater van at the 2007 Thailand Motor Expo. The Hyundai H1 - also known as the Hyundai Starex in certain markets - is a van that can be configured with either 8 or 11 seats aimed at customers who wish to have a people mover but do not want to spend so much on luxury MPVs (multi-purpose vehicles). The Hyundai Starex goes head to head against vehicles such as the Ford Transit, the Volkswagen Transporter and the Mercedes Benz Vito. The Thai model is configured with 11 seats.

With its sophisticated lines, the all-new H-1 (project codename TQ) improves on its predecessor in every measurable respect. More spacious, more comfortable and more convenient, the new H-1 reinvigorates Hyundai's competitiveness in this hotly contested segment.

For all markets outside of Korea and the EU, power for the new Hyundai Starex is provided by a 2.5-liter turbocharged intercooled engine (4D56). Euro-III emissions-compliant, the 4D56 delivers 100ps of horsepower and 23kg m of torque whilst delivering 9.4km per litre of fuel. It's mated to a five-speed manual gearbox or the optional four-speed automatic.
Hyundai Starex 2008
The new H-1 Starex is also fitted with an electro-chromic rear view mirror and new roof-mounted air vents for improved cooling and heating throughout the cabin. The new H-1 gets 16-inch front disc brakes providing better braking power than the H-1's 15-inch discs. And for improved handling, it's fitted with a MacPherson strut front suspension.

Apparently the Starex has always been a popular vehicle in the Philippines:

EVER since Hyundai Starex appeared in the Philippine market several years ago, the Korean-made family van has developed quite a following that now its buyers demanded more than just discounts and efficient after-sales service.

"The market deserves more so we decided to bring the latest Starex here," said Ma. Fe Agudo, managing director at Hyundai Asia Resources Inc. (Hari), the exclusive distributor of Hyundai automotive products in the Philippines.
